What is XP in Fidella?

XP is the internal score Fidella calculates from loyalty activity, breadth across venues, and spend. It feeds the nightly Fidella tier calculation. Customers can see it as supporting context, but the Fidella tier is the status that actually counts.

Also called: Experience points.

XP is scoring infrastructure rather than a customer-facing promise.

What it is for

XP accumulates from loyalty activity, from how many different venues a customer uses, and from spend. A nightly job turns XP into a Fidella tier.

Why it is not the headline

Tier is the canonical status field, and XP is deliberately kept as supporting context. A visible points score invites customers to treat it as a contract, which it is not: the weighting is tuned centrally and the cutoffs move.
